Entries for the Glass Focus Awards 2020 are now open with this year’s event featuring a virtual presentation ceremony, on Thursday 12 November.

Running alongside an increased online presence, the virtual ceremony, black tie optional, will be an opportunity for us to come together and celebrate the achievements of our industry in what has been a strange year for all of us.

Entries can be worked on and submitted from today and as always, we are looking for people, products and projects that showcase the very best of the glass industry from the last 12 months. 

It’s completely free to enter and you can enter as many categories as you like – whether you are a member of British Glass or not. The categories for the 2020 awards are:

  • Design of the year – container
  • Design of the year – flat
  • Innovative solution
  • Health and safety action
  • Sustainable practice
  • Rising Star
  • Strengthening business through people
  • Marketing impact

What's more - all British Glass members entering any category will be put forward for the title of British Glass Company of the year.

British Glass CEO Dave Dalton said:

“Like many businesses we’ve had to adapt to the current circumstances and one of the consequences of that is Glass Focus going digital for the first time.

“However, by moving the ceremony online it has allowed us to make some additions both to the ceremony and to our coverage of the winners, including shortlists for each awards category, a British Glass Best Practice award for individuals, organisations or charity groups championing glass and recycling  and a full profile on each of the winners following the awards.

“Glass Focus is designed to celebrate the glass sector and while this year’s ceremony will be different, we will still highlight the very best of what our industry has to offer.”

The closing date for entries is 12 noon on Wednesday 23 September – we are looking forward to seeing what the industry has been up to in the last year.
